I need RichTextArea for my TextPresenter
I have an interface TextPresenter, and TextPresenterImp.java as its
implementation:
public class TextPresenterImp extends BasePresenter<Display>
implements TextPresenter{
@Inject
public TextPresenterImp(EventBus eventBus, Display display) {
super(eventBus, display);
}
@Override
public void bind() {
super.bind();
}
I also have a TextWidget.java what extends Composite and implements
Display, and there knows the objects in TextWidget.ui.xml
Now it looks like this:
public class TextWidget extends Composite implements Display{
private static TextWidgetUiBinder uiBinder =
GWT.create(TextWidgetUiBinder.class);
@UiTemplate("ui/TextWidget.ui.xml")
interface TextWidgetUiBinder extends UiBinder<Widget, TextWidget> {
}
@UiField RichTextArea textInputField;
public TextWidget() {
initWidget(uiBinder.createAndBindUi(this));
}
public HasHTML getEnteredText() {
return this.textInputField;
}
public Widget asWidget() {
return this;
}
}
And my TextWidget.ui.xml looks like this:
<!DOCTYPE ui:UiBinder SYSTEM "http://dl.google.com/gwt/DTD/xhtml.ent">
<ui:UiBinder xmlns:ui="urn:ui:com.google.gwt.uibinder"
xmlns:g="urn:import:com.google.gwt.user.client.ui">
<g:HTMLPanel>
<g:RichTextArea ui:field="textInputField"></g:RichTextArea>
</g:HTMLPanel>
</ui:UiBinder>
The problem is that if TextWidget is shown, it only has the text input
fielt, but no text formation toolbar
